Offender Information

Last Statement

Date of Execution:

July 24, 2003

Offender:

Allen Janecka #684

Last Statement:

First of all, I want to say God bless everyone here today. For many years I have done things my way, which caused a lot of pain to me, my family and many others. Today I have come to realize that for peace and happiness, one has to do things God's way. I want to thank my family for their support. I love you. I am taking you with me. You all stay strong. I love you. I also want to say thanks to the Chaplains who I have met through the years and who have brought me a long way. And I cherish you as my family and at this time...oh, Ken, my little son, I am coming to see you. Oh Lord, into your hands I commit my spirit. Thy will be done.
